Crafting the Future of Flavor: Tapal Tea’s AI-Powered Approach to the Modern Tea Industry
Tapal Tea, a renowned family-owned business in Pakistan, has grown from a single retail outlet in 1947 to one of the country’s largest tea brands. With a presence in Pakistan, Saudi Arabia, and 20 other countries, Tapal Tea’s journey underscores the successful blending of tradition with innovation. AI in Quality Control and Tea Blending
Tea blending, a critical component in delivering consistent flavor profiles, involves evaluating various tea grades to meet consumer expectations. Tapal Tea already carries out research at its Tapal Tea Lab, and the integration of AI could further optimize these operations. Machine learning algorithms could analyze vast data sets, including historical quality data, sensory inputs, and consumer feedback, to identify optimal blends and reduce variations. These AI systems can also leverage computer vision to assess tea leaves’ color, texture, and quality in real-time, ensuring only high-quality leaves make it through the production line.
